Summary: The Compressed Gas Association (CGA), representing over 160 member companies, generally supports the current balance between safety benefits and compliance costs regarding pipeline anomaly repair criteria and remediation timelines. They request that any new technologies not be mandated without allowing for the continued use of existing methods, particularly to protect smaller businesses, and suggest providing relief on remediation timelines for pipelines supplying critical facilities.
